Strategic Applications of White in Home Design

To maximize the impact of white in interior spaces, experts recommend several strategic applications. First, consider the balance between white and contrasting colours. Incorporating bold accents, such as deep blues or vibrant greens, can provide depth and visual interest. Studies show that a well-placed accent can enhance the overall appeal of a predominantly white space.

Additionally, texture plays a crucial role in elevating white interiors. Mixing materials such as wood, metal, and fabric can create a layered look, adding warmth to an otherwise stark palette. Designers frequently suggest using textured wall treatments or varied furniture finishes to break up the monotony of white surfaces.

Lighting is another essential factor in the effective use of white. Natural light can significantly alter the perception of white, making spaces feel airy and expansive. On the other hand, artificial lighting can create different moods and tones, which can either enhance or detract from the intended design effect. In a recent interview, acclaimed interior designer Sarah Thompson noted, “The way light interacts with white can completely change the atmosphere of a room.”

Trends and Future Outlook

The trend of using white in home interiors is expected to continue growing in popularity throughout 2024 and beyond. As urban living spaces become smaller, the need for colours that can create an illusion of space becomes increasingly important. White not only reflects light but also makes rooms appear larger, a feature that appeals to many city dwellers.

Moreover, the sustainability movement in design is influencing colour choices. White surfaces are often easier to refresh and maintain, allowing homeowners to update their spaces without extensive renovations. This aligns with a growing preference for eco-friendly practices in home improvement.
